Maison  >  Article  >  développement back-end  >  Résumé de la façon d'utiliser les constantes php

Résumé de la façon d'utiliser les constantes php

伊谢尔伦
伊谢尔伦original
2017-06-29 10:42:521610parcourir

Cet article présente principalement les informations pertinentes sur la connaissance des constantes en PHP. Les amis dans le besoin peuvent se référer aux

Les constantes en PHP sont divisées en constantes personnalisées et constantes système.

Fonctionnalités constantes :

  1. Après le réglage, la valeur de la constante ne peut pas être modifiée

  2. Nom de la constante Le Le signe dollar ($) n'est pas requis

  3. La portée n'affecte pas l'accès aux constantes

  4. Les valeurs constantes ne peuvent être que caractères Chaîne ou nombre

Récupérer la valeur d'une constante :

  • Utiliser le nom de la constante pour obtenir directement la valeur ;

  • Utilisez ==constant()== function, qui a le même effet que d'utiliser directement le nom de la constante pour générer, mais la fonction peut générer dynamiquement différents constantes, vous devez donc utiliser Flexible et pratique.

Fonction définie() : Déterminer si une constante a été définie

define("PI",3.14);

$is1 = defined('PI');
$is2 = defined('PI1');

var_dump($is1); // boolean true
var_dump($is2); // boolean false

Constante personnalisée

En PHP, utilisez la fonction ==define()== pour définir une constante

define("PI",3.14);
echo constant('PI');

define("GREETING","Hello world!",TRUE);
echo constant('greeting');

Constantes système

Constantes système communes. Il y a :

1. FILE : nom du fichier du programme PHP. Cela peut nous aider à obtenir l'emplacement physique du fichier actuel sur le serveur.

2. LINE : Le nombre de lignes dans le fichier du programme PHP. Il peut nous dire sur quelle ligne se trouve le code actuel.

3. PHP_VERSION : Le numéro de version de l'analyseur actuel. Il peut nous indiquer le numéro de version de l'analyseur PHP actuel, et nous pouvons savoir à l'avance si notre code PHP peut être analysé par l'analyseur PHP.

4. PHP_OS : Le nom du système d'exploitation qui exécute la version actuelle de PHP. Il peut nous indiquer le nom du système d'exploitation utilisé par le serveur et nous pouvons optimiser notre code en fonction de ce système d'exploitation.

echo FILE; // E:\Web\Project\_wamp\demo.php
echo LINE; // 3
echo PHP_VERSION; // 5.6.25
echo PHP_OS; // WINNT

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n